    Quote Originally Posted by truelegitballer View Post
    tabang! nag problema jud ko aning limited connectivity nga issue! ani ang structure sa akong connection:


    modem ---> router -----> 4 PCs = no problem with the connection

    modem ---> switch -----> 4 PCs = Limited Connectivity


    unsay blema ani? tabang tawn mga master!
    you need to switch your modem to Routing mode. if its in Bridge mode, you need a dialer to pick up connection and share it (this is what routers do).

    but if you can reconfigure that modem to routing mode and enable DHCP, without mistakes then you are good to go... failure to the right stuff may cause your modem not to connect again even if you place a router agen through it. and this will require you to ask assistance from globe techs to restore its original settings.

    the primary cause of limited connectivity is due because there are no DHCP servers on your network, nothing to give each computer their own IP address.
